Isaan migrant worker meets his final fate on a South Korean pig farm

April 1, 2023April 1, 2023

Thai workers die in South Korea the most in the world, at least 522 cases died in the last 6 years, and 86% of them are 'little ghosts'. One of them was Boonchu Prawasanang native from Khon Kaen province.
